临床上膀胱肿瘤的性质存在很大差异,高度分化之肿瘤通常为整倍体,低度分化肿瘤则伴非整倍体。当肿瘤由分化较好向分化稍差发展,处于不典型的形态学变化时,根据目前组织病理学分级方法,尚难以作出确切的判断,将涉及病人的治疗与预后。为进一步建立鉴定肿瘤性质的客观分级方法,本文作者应用流动细胞荧光分析法(Flowcytofluorometric method),对膀胱肿瘤活体组织进行细胞倍体与增殖的测定,并与膀胱冲洗脱落细胞、组织病理学与细胞学的改变进
